Abstract
Network equipment (300) is configured as a proxy (40, 50) for one of multiple different core network domains of a wireless communication system (10). The network equipment (300, 400) is configured to receive a message (60) that has been, or is to be, transmitted between the different core network domains. The network equipment (300, 400) is further configured to perform inter-domain security measures according to a security policy (80). The security policy (80) may indicate which one or more portions of (e.g., the content of a field in) the message (60) are to be used by inter-domain security measures (e.g., inter-domain anti-spoofing measures) and/or which types of messages are to be used by the inter-domain security measures.
